摘要
The present invention relates to polymer semipermeable microcapsules using photopolymerization-induced phase separation, and a method of preparing the same. Specifically, the present invention relates to polymer semipermeable microcapsules and a method of preparing the same, wherein the polymer semipermeable microcapsules use the phase separation of porogen and polymer produced from emitting UV rays in double-emulsion drops in which photopolymerizable monomers and porogen form an intermediate phase to polymerize the monomers. The present invention may form uniform pores with controllable size in a shell by using the porogen type and concentration, and the phase separation characteristics thereof with polymer monomers. Since the present invention forms the shell by polymerizing photopolymerizable monomers, the present invention can provide microcapsules that are relatively independent of influences of solvents or pH conditions, are chemically stable, and have excellent mechanical characteristics as well. Also, the microcapsules of the present invention possess pores of a size ranging from a few nanometers to a few hundred nanometers and thus are capable of controlling materials flowing in and out of the interior of the microcapsules.;COPYRIGHT KIPO 2017
